Basic CRM, looking for automated workflows, look elsewhere!

Revisado el 2/5/2019

Copper is our CRM and is only used for our sales team. Our products are a mobile app and website...

Copper is our CRM and is only used for our sales team. Our products are a mobile app and website that generate leads that go into Copper in which our sales team is able to qualify and view all communication with prospects and move them along the appropriate pipeline.

One of the main problems that Copper solves for us is integrating with Slack and their mobile app to update us real-time of new leads. Also, a nice feature of Copper is their integration with G Suite (since Copper is a Google Product), that keeps track of all communication with each prospect.

From a more technical perspective, Copper has a quite robust API that allows us to connect our mobile app attribution platform, Slack, PostgresSQL, and chatbot Intercom.

Puntos a favor

One of the main benefits of Copper is real-time reports. We are able to breakdown won and lost revenue amongst our sales team and also account for projected sales revenue based on the opportunities in the pipeline and the expected close rate of those opportunities.

Copper has automated actions that allow us to move prospects through pipelines effectively. We set automated reminders and tasks for opportunities based on their pipeline and stage within the pipeline. These reminders and tasks are also emailed and sent as a push notification to each respective lead owner.Copper has automated actions that allow us to move prospects through pipelines effectively. We set automated reminders and tasks for opportunities based on their pipeline and stage within the pipeline. These reminders and tasks are also emailed and sent as a push notification to each respective lead owner.

We are a big fan of the Copper newsletters. They provide a clear roadmap of what to expect from them from a product development standpoint and what to expect next. Their emails are easy to digest, and optimized for mobile. Also, they ask for user input that has been integrated into their roadmap.

Puntos en contra

While Copper has a quite robust API, they do not have any webhook receiver URLs. In order to effectively communicate data between Copper and another platform is through a paid Zapier account or Tray.io.

Automated actions are nice, but the work flow automations are extremely limited. We are not able to send users automated emails, push notifications when they enter a new stage of a pipeline.

More direct integrations with messaging services - transactional + marketing email services, push notification platforms, chat services.

Alternativas consideradas

ActiveCampaign, Salesforce Sales Cloud y HubSpot CRM

Razones para cambiar a Copper

I didn't have much authorization in the selection of Copper, however, I have looked into switching costs and leaving Copper due to their limited workflow automations. Hubspot and Salesforce look more robust and integrated with our other marketing tools. We are too sunk in with Copper into Slack, our backend, and current sales process to switch over and learn again. As a result, we have decided to stick with Copper and wait anxiously for their new product updates.

Best CRM I’ve come across!

Revisado el 24/9/2023

Overall I think it’s very user friendly and I love that the app is also very convenient to use....

Overall I think it’s very user friendly and I love that the app is also very convenient to use. Helps it’s stay organized on the go as well. It also very rarely crashes. I would say it has crashed twice in the 4+ years I’ve been using it.

Puntos a favor

I love that we are able to track everything related to a specific client. Every email, text, phone calls, task, state a case is in, etc. You can also make calls straight from the mobile copper app! So convenient. The administrator is able to customize the contacts to include what is necessary for their type of business. It also shows when some created a task, assigned a task, completed it.

Puntos en contra

The only issue I can complain about is not about Copper itself but about the extension I have installed to chrome. I love that I can sync/relate emails to copper contacts so that all correspondence related to a contact shows up on that individuals copper—especially since we receive emails from courts, prosecutors, etc. and it’s helpful to sort the emails to the correct contact in copper. My main complaint is that once you “relate” an email to copper, you can’t unrelate it. Since we have hundreds of active cases at a time and we receive hundreds of emails daily, it’s easy to accidentally relate it to the wrong person. The only fix I’ve found is that you can delete the email in the copper contact feed (it does not delete it from Gmail) but it does leave a block in the feed that says “this email was deleted” which of course doesn’t look good. Really wish there was a way to unrelate emails altogether.

Extremely Limited

Revisado el 22/11/2016

Tried PW for my insurance biz. It was a total waste of time. It took 20+ hours to set up for my...

Tried PW for my insurance biz. It was a total waste of time. It took 20+ hours to set up for my business and did very little to help organize contacts/meetings/notes as I required. Also needed to be able to filter/search for data.

Overall, it lacked customization.

Wanted to add custom fields like birthdates. This proved impossible, as the date field required input via pop up calendar, so you'd have to click through every month to get back to January 1 1965. I talked to their support people for a total of 3 hours and the conclusion of it all was "the software can't do that and we're not going to implement that unless a ton of people ask for it." That should have been a red flag because it just got worse.

Importing data is super annoying. If you have a google sheet you want to import, you have to download it as a CSV then re-upload it, and hope the fields match up. It also adds a bunch of tags to crap that makes a huge data mess you end up wasting hours to fix.

The dashboard is a total waste of space. There is no useful information. The People section is basically a glorified Excel spread sheet. When you export your data it grabs the fields, but leaves all of the activity notes behind, so you cannot back those

Custom filters are another massive failure. If you want to filter by X but exclude everyone who already has Y, it's impossible. I think an undergrad designed this system because it lacks advanced features severely.

If you want to set up a daily to-do queue, forget it. You might as well use paper checklist or a spreadsheet.

Another major problem is that it will pull info out of your google contacts and if you check the box for Sync with Contacts, it will completely destroy your hardwork in contacts. It deletes data out of fields, such as addresses and phone numbers. You have to pay for another software called Pieworks to fix that, but it's also terrible. A simple basic feature that should be included is not, and you have to pay yet another monthly sub for something really stupid that should be there.

It has an app for android, and it was convenient when out of the office. You can pull up the contact and if you just had a meeting with them, dictate the notes into logging a meeting. If you need to call them, just tap their phone number, and at the end of the call PW is already logging your call, just enter the notes about topics of discussion. However, the app needs improvement in terms of the dashboard, such as calendar and to do list like a call queue or other service tasks.

You have to submit tickets for every little thing. It's extremely annoying and waste of your time.

I decided to cancel this, pulled all of my data out of PW and set it up in a spreadsheet. PW is barely more than a spreadsheet with a pretty interface. It's not worth the money. You might as well use something free -- or spend the money and get a real CRM with all the features you really need.
They will not let you cancel. There is no place to remove your billing information or cancel your plan. You have to submit a ticket and hope they answer it, but more likely, they'll ignore it because they are a greedy company that ignores the requests users make on their website for changes.

They claim they are the CRM google uses, but that's not true. This is a very immature piece of software that cannot handle a serious business with specialized needs. They may have partnered with
